Pfeiffer Splitflow 310 Split Flow Turbo Pump PMP03626E / PM P03 626 E, with TC 400, PMC01805, PM P03 626E , Agilent G2571-80310 for Agilent 6430 QQQ Mass Spec
SplitFlow 310 / PM P03 626E, Agilent P/N G2571-80310 Turbo Pump has a wear free permanent magnetic bearing at the high vacuum side and a oil lubricated ceramic bearing at the backing pump side.

A turbopump is a gas turbine that is made up of two independent components ; a rotodynamic pump and a driving turbine. They can be mounted on the same shaft or customarily geared together. The design of a turbopump is to produce a high pressure fluid for feeding a combustion chamber or other use. Visit the turbo pump wiki page for more information.
A turbomolecular pump is a form of vacuum pump similar to a turbopump which is used to obtain and hold a high vacuum. These pumps work on the principle that gas particles can be given momentum in a wanted direction by reiterated collision with a traveling solid surface. In a turbomolecular pump, a quickly spinning turbine rotor 'strikes' gas particles from the intake of the pump towards the exhaust in order to make or hold a vacuum.
